A Book/Exhibition You Have To Touch

black-book-of-colors

The Children’s Museum of the Arts is celebrating the innovative artwork of Menena Cottin and Rosana Faria with an exhibition dedicated to their children’s book The Black Book of Colors. Winner of the 2007 New Horizons Award at the Bologna Children’s Book Fair, the book teaches sighted children how people without sight can experience colors through sound, smell, touch and taste. As part of the educational programming inspired by the exhibition, CMA has partnered with Lighthouse International, a non-profit organization dedicated to providing critically needed vision and rehabilitation services, to explore art projects with their Pre-kindergarten and Kindergarten students. The original artwork created by the children will also be displayed at CMA.”
